WNS Trade Limit Broker Review
Abstract:WNS Trade Limit, established in 2023, is a forex broker incorporated in Mauritius under registration number C200345. The company operates under the jurisdiction of the Financial Services Commission (FSC) of Mauritius, holding license number GB232201953.

WNS Trade Limit, established in 2023, is a forex broker incorporated in Mauritius under registration number C200345. The company operates under the jurisdiction of the Financial Services Commission (FSC) of Mauritius, holding license number GB232201953. This regulatory framework allows WNS Trade to offer a variety of financial trading services, including forex, CFDs, precious metals, and index/stock trading.
Regulatory Status
WNS Trade is regulated offshore by the FSC under a retail forex license. While the FSC provides a regulatory framework for financial services in Mauritius, it is important to note that offshore regulation may not offer the same level of investor protection as more established financial authorities. Therefore, potential clients should exercise caution and conduct thorough due diligence before engaging with the broker.

Trading Conditions
The broker offers a tiered leverage system based on account balances:
- Balances up to $50,000: Leverage of 1:500
- Balances between $50,001 and $100,000: Leverage of 1:200
- Balances over $100,000: Leverage of 1:100
These leverage options provide flexibility for traders with varying account sizes.
Trading Platform
WNS Trade utilizes the MetaTrader 5 (MT5) platform, a widely recognized and user-friendly system suitable for both novice and experienced traders. The platform is accessible across multiple devices, including desktop computers, Android, and iOS devices, ensuring a seamless trading experience.
Customer Support
Customer support is available from Monday to Saturday, between 8:00 AM and 6:00 PM. Clients can reach out via contact form, phone at +2302149926, or email at support@wnstrade.com. The company's physical address is 22, St Georges Street, Port-Louis, Mauritius.
Payment Methods
WNS Trade offers a variety of payment methods for deposits and withdrawals, including Visa/Mastercard, Neteller, POLi, and BPay. Additionally, the broker supports third-party payment options such as WeChat and Alipay, catering to a diverse clientele.
Regional Restrictions
It's important to note that WNS Trade does not provide services to residents of certain countries, including the USA, Canada, Haiti, Suriname, the Democratic Republic of Korea, Japan, and Belgium.
Conclusion
While WNS Trade offers a range of trading services and competitive leverage options, its offshore regulatory status and relatively short operational history may raise concerns for some traders. Potential clients are advised to conduct thorough research and consider the associated risks before engaging with the broker. Additionally, the broker's score of 5.78/10 from WikiFX suggests a medium potential risk, indicating the need for caution.
